Maximize Your PPC’s Efficiency With e-Commerce Tracking
In the world of ecommerce one idea is king: profit. As the old saying goes ‘revenue is vanity, profit is sanity’ and it is for this reason that properly optimized PPC can help keep all e-commerce website owners very sane and very happy. By setting up Google Analytics’ e-commerce tracking to integrate with your PPC data you can track the exact amount of revenue made on your site … [Read more...] about Maximize Your PPC’s Efficiency With e-Commerce Tracking

Geo-targeting
Geo-Targeting This process explains how to change the location targeting settings for a campaign. You can make your campaigns target any combination of countries, territories, regions, cities, and customized areas defined by you. You can also target up to 40 different languages. · Go to ‘All Online Campaigns’ and select the Campaign that you want to change settings … [Read more...] about Geo-targeting
